
During December 2025, Szescxz contributed to the persian-calendar/persian-calendar repository by implementing Chinese (Simplified Han) localization for the Persian Calendar application. Focusing on internationalization and translation, Szescxz updated the strings.xml file to support the new locale, enhancing both accessibility and usability for Chinese-speaking users. The work was managed through Weblate, achieving 86.6% translation coverage by translating 345 out of 398 UI strings. Although no bugs were recorded during this period, Szescxz’s efforts centered on translation accuracy and UI consistency.
